  • The Arcade version had no upcoming cars to avoid and also none of the decoration like houses and trees. Also it was in black and white (although it doesn't make lot of a difference). I think the road was narrower in the Arcade, so even without the upcoming cars it was propably harder than the Atari version.

    Night Driver has been the first driving Arcade game that didn't use an overhead view but this "pseudo-3D" perspective style.
